A 19th Century treat added in response to a thread. This candy Traditionaly eaten for good luck on the New Year.

Time 1h

Yield 1 hedgehog.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 lb blanched almond, pulverized (suggest food processor, here)
2 cups confectioners' sugar
8 tablespoons rose water or 8 tablespoons egg whites
2 cloves
cinnamon
1 package slivered almonds

Steps:

  • Beat together almond paste, sugar and rose water (or egg white) into a workable consistancy.
  • Shape into a hedgehog body, head, snout and ears.
  • The inside of ears may be colored with cinnamon.
  • Carefully attach body parts, then add cloves for eyes.
  • Press slivered almonds into body so they stand up resembling spines.
  • Air dry.
